Subject: Handover — Splitgate assignment service

Hi Renata,

Taking over Splitgate? The A/B assignment service hashes user IDs into experiment buckets and logs assignments nightly. Support should watch for bucket skew alerts; anything over 2% warrants a page. Config changes go through the experiments review board. To inspect assignments directly, use the connection string below.

replica DSN, fadup-yagug: mssql://rusox_svc:0K2wrVJefbkR2n@db-53b3.qirvangrid.example:5432/istix

Finance team: renewal terms from Halbrook Mutual are in. Property premium up 9%, liability up 4%, cyber flat after the Dravon audit improvements. Aggregate deductible unchanged. Broker secured a two-year rate lock on the marine cargo line covering the Penwick route. Total programme cost lands 6% over budget; variance absorbed by the contingency reserve. Recommend binding by the 15th to hold quotes. Alternative carrier bids were weaker across all lines. Strategic context for the coverage decision follows below.

board note of bawep-tajef: Queniusek Systems plans to raise the Quenvan list price by 53.1 percent in March. The pricing group signed off on a budget of $176.4 million for Project Drueth. The renewal with Casionix Partners closes at $142.5 million a year, 8.3 percent below the last contract. Project Fraax slips by six weeks because of the tooling delay.

Ticket: VELT-2281 — Load test blocked on expired credentials

The Cartwheel checkout flow load test failed overnight because the synthetic-buyer account credentials expired Sunday. All 12 runner nodes returned auth errors before ramp-up. Renewal was approved by the platform team this morning; tests resume tonight. For the sync: runners now authenticate against the internal payments sandbox using the key below.

API key for yahig-tadup: kto7_ubizbYm